[SRP] GameObject from incorrect Layer is getting rendered with Occlusion culling when stacking Cameras
How to reproduce:
1. Open the attached "1294584_repro.zip" project
2. Open the "SampleScene" Scene
3. Go to Window -> Rendering -> Occlusion Culling
4. Press "Bake" in the Inspector
5. Select the "Main Camera" GameObject in the Hierarchy window
6. Observe the Game view
Expected result: Image from UI Layer is getting rendered with the UI Camera
Actual result: GameObject from the Default Layer is getting rendered with the UI Camera
Reproducible with: 7.5.1 (2019.4.15f1), 8.2.0 (2020.1.15f1), 10.2.0 (2020.2.0b13, 2021.1.0a7)
